Open day a success!

 

Local residents turned out to help celebrate Tattenhoe Sports Pavilion’s open day on Sunday 2nd April.

 

Activities and demonstrations were provided by community groups already enjoying the use of the new building including a 5-a-side football tournament, shotokan karate and Aikido demonstrations.

 

‘The Great Gappo’ kept the little ones entertained whilst Paul Heald from MK Dons presented souvenir footballs to children who participated in a penalty shoot-out against him.

 

Phil Collins, Chief Executive of Hertsmere Leisure, welcomed guests to the Pavilion and Milton Keynes' Mayor Phil Gerrella officially opened the new building, encouraging the community to make use of the excellent new facilities being built in Milton Keynes.

 

Contracts Manager Scott Beattie said “We hope the community will continue to enjoy the facilities available here and work with us to develop Tattenhoe as an invaluable community venue for all to enjoy.''
